What is the easiest Citi credit card to get?

Asked by: Dr. Adell Rath  |  Last update: September 22, 2025
Score: 4.9/5 (43 votes)

The Citi Secured Mastercard is the easiest Citi credit card to get because it's the only Citi card that will accept applicants with limited credit (less than 3 years of credit history). The Citi Secured card requires a $200 refundable security deposit, but it has a $0 annual fee.

What is the minimum credit score for a Costco Citi card?

Bottom line. To get approved for the Costco Anywhere Visa® Card by Citi you'll typically need a FICO® score of 800 or higher. This cash-back card doesn't have an annual fee, but you'll need a Costco membership to apply.

What is the 8 65 rule for Citi?

What is the Citi 8/65 rule? Citi's 8/65 rule states that applicants are ineligible to apply for more than one Citi credit card in eight days, and not more than two credit cards in 65 days.

What is the minimum income for Citibank credit card?

Citibank does not have a specific minimum salary requirement for its credit cards, though applicants must report an annual income sufficient to make a card's minimum payment every month. Citibank is one of several major credit card issuers that do not publicly disclose a specific salary or income requirement.

What credit does Citi pull from?

Citibank mainly uses Experian to assess your creditworthiness when you apply for a credit card, though they may use TransUnion or Equifax instead, according to anecdotal evidence. So, if any of your credit reports are frozen, you should unfreeze them before applying for a Citibank credit card.

What is the average Citi credit limit?

The usual Citibank credit card limit is $200 to $2,000 at a minimum, depending on the card. The Citi Double Cash® Card has a $500 minimum credit limit, for example, while the Citi Strata Premier℠ Card has a minimum credit limit of $2,000. Citibank doesn't publicly disclose any maximum credit limits.

Can I get an Apple Card with a 580 credit score?

If your credit score is low

Goldman Sachs evaluates your Apple Card application using TransUnion and other credit bureaus. If your credit score is low (for example, if your FICO® Score 9 is lower than 600),6 Goldman Sachs might be unable to approve your Apple Card application.
